Warning Signs You Need Professional Sprinkler System Water Removal

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to bigger problems and more expensive repairs.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call us today to schedule an assessment and get your home back to normal.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ong musty odors can show high levels of moisture in your home, which can lead to mold growth and further damage. Our team uses specialized equipment to identify and remove the source of the odor.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age and can lead to further structural issues. Our team uses specialized equipment to dry and restore your flooring.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age and can lead to further issues with your home’s integrity. Our team uses specialized equipment to dry and restore your walls.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ains can show water damage and can lead to further issues with your home’s integrity. Our team uses specialized equipment to dry and restore your ceilings and walls.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ks can show water damage and can lead to further structural issues. Our team uses specialized equipment to identify and repair any damage.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age can show a serious issue that needs to be addressed immediately. Our team uses specialized equipment to dry and restore your home.

Sprinkler System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) Yes No You can clean it up yourself with a mop and towels.
Large water spill (more than 10 gallons) No Yes You need specialized equipment to dry and restore your home.
Water damage to structural elements (e.g. Walls, flooring) No Yes You need a professional to assess and repair any damage.
Mold growth or musty odors No Yes You need a professional to identify and remove the source of the odor.
Water damage to electrical or plumbing systems No Yes You need a professional to assess and repair any damage to your home’s systems.

Sprinkler System Water Removal Cost in Wylie, TX

The cost of sprinkler system water removal can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Wylie, TX.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and severity of damage.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and duration of drying process.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of cleaning products used.
Final Inspection and Rest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and extent of repairs needed.

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ates to ensure you know what to expect.
